Corporate Flight Management
Corporate Flight Management (CFM) has ``kid-proofed'' a Cessna 150 for the National Air and Space Museum's (NASM) ``How Things Fly'' exhibit -- where museum visitors are invited to sit in the trainer to operate the controls and get a sense of flight in the aircraft.
